  • Patent number: 8984219
    Abstract: A method is provided for writing data in a storage device, including a nonvolatile memory. The method includes receiving a pre-write command including a logical address and size information of write data, performing a pre-operation for optimization of a write operation based on the pre-write command, and writing the write data in the nonvolatile memory after the pre-operation is completed.

  • Patent number: 8612836
    Abstract: The non-volatile memory system includes a non-volatile memory and a controller. The non-volatile memory includes a data region including a sector region for storing sector data, and an uncorrectable information region for storing uncorrectable sector information on the sector region. The controller includes an information generation unit for generating the uncorrectable sector information that indicates whether the sector region is assigned to an uncorrectable sector region, according to a command output from a host.

  • Patent number: 8599322
    Abstract: Provided are a 2-dimensional and 3-dimensional image display device and a method of manufacturing the same. The display device includes: an image display panel including first and second substrates with a first liquid crystal layer interposed therebetween; a switching panel including third and fourth substrates with a second liquid crystal layer interposed therebetween; and a backlight unit for supplying light to the image display panel and the switching panel.

  • Patent number: 8593884
    Abstract: A data retention method that includes sampling a plurality of nonvolatile memory devices included in a data storage device to detect retention information for each of the nonvolatile memory devices in response to a request of a host and outputting, from the data storage device to the host, sampling data based on a result of the sampling, determining, at the host, whether to perform a retention operation on each of the nonvolatile memory devices based on the sampling data, and performing the retention operation on each of the nonvolatile memory devices based on a result of the determination.

  • Publication number: 20120210076
    Abstract: Disclosed is a method of operating a data storage device. The method includes; causing the data storage device to transition from an off-line state to an on-line state, receiving a current global time as communicated from a host during the on-line state, and during the on-line state, refreshing data stored in the data storage device in response to the current global time using at least one normal data retention operation.

  • Patent number: 7630030
    Abstract: Disclosed is an LCD device and a method for fabricating the same is disclosed, which maximizes light efficiency by compensating for light transmissivity resulting from the alignment of the liquid crystal in a plurality of alignment domains within a pixel region. Compensation is accomplished by a polarizing sheet having a plurality of polarizing regions corresponding to the alignment domains, wherein each polarizing region has a transmission angle that corresponds to the alignment angle of the corresponding domain so that light leakage in a black state can be minimized.

  • Patent number: 7495725
    Abstract: A transflective LCD includes an upper substrate having a common electrode formed therein; a lower substrate spaced apart by a predetermined interval from the upper substrate and facing the upper substrate, the lower substrate having a pixel region including a switching region, a reflection part, and a transmission part, and including a delta film, a thin film transistor layer, a color filter layer and a reflector formed therein; a liquid crystal layer interposed between the upper substrate and the lower substrate; and a backlight assembly disposed below the lower substrate, for supplying light toward the lower substrate.

  • Patent number: 7027113
    Abstract: An LCD includes a liquid crystal panel, first and second polarizing plates attached to opposing surfaces of the liquid crystal panel, a first front light unit over a front side of the liquid crystal panel, a second front light unit over a rear side of the liquid crystal panel, a first film disposed between the first polarizing plate and the first front light unit, for receiving a surrounding light and directing the surrounding light toward the rear side of the liquid crystal panel, and a diffusion sheet disposed between the second polarizing plate and the second front light unit.
